首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

MongoDB采集字段与当前日期进行比较,获取一天的活跃用户数

MongoDB是一种开源的NoSQL数据库,它采用文档存储模式,适用于处理大量非结构化数据。在云计算领域,MongoDB被广泛应用于各种场景,如Web应用程序、移动应用程序、物联网设备等。

要获取一天的活跃用户数,可以使用MongoDB的聚合框架和日期操作符来实现。以下是一个示例查询:

代码语言:txt
复制
db.collection.aggregate([
  {
    $match: {
      timestamp: {
        $gte: ISODate("2022-01-01T00:00:00Z"), // 开始日期
        $lt: ISODate("2022-01-02T00:00:00Z") // 结束日期
      }
    }
  },
  {
    $group: {
      _id: null,
      count: { $sum: 1 }
    }
  }
])

上述查询中,db.collection表示要查询的集合名称,timestamp是存储用户活动时间的字段。通过$match操作符筛选出指定日期范围内的文档,然后使用$group操作符对匹配的文档进行分组,并使用$sum操作符计算活跃用户数。

对于MongoDB的相关产品和介绍,腾讯云提供了云数据库MongoDB(TencentDB for MongoDB)服务。该服务提供了高可用、高性能、弹性扩展的MongoDB数据库实例,适用于各种规模的应用场景。您可以通过腾讯云官网了解更多关于云数据库MongoDB的信息:云数据库MongoDB产品介绍

请注意,以上答案仅供参考,具体实现方式可能因应用场景和数据结构而有所不同。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券